As the world ages, cancer cases are projected to rise, hitting some countries like ‘a tidal wave’
- Lung, breast, and colorectal cancers are the most common types globally, with cervical cancer causing the most deaths in 37 countries.
- HPV vaccine can lower cervical cancer risk, but only 15% of eligible girls globally have received it. Disparities exist in cervical cancer screenings.
- Leading causes of cancer deaths include lung, colorectal, liver, and breast cancers, with significant impact on sub-Saharan Africa, South America, and southeastern Asia.
